Laboratory Abnormalities of Hepatic Encephalopathy
Briette Verken Karanfilian1, Maggie Cheung1, Peter Dellatore1
1Department of Internal Medicine, Rutgers-Robert Wood Johnson Medical School, New Brunswick, NJ, USA; Department of Medicine, 125 Paterson Street, New Brunswick, NJ 08901, USA.
Diagnosing hepatic encephalopathy (HE) currently relies on clinical assessment, as no definitive blood tests or imaging exist. Electroencephalography shows promise for diagnosing minimal HE when combined with specific scoring systems.

Background:
- Hepatic encephalopathy (HE) diagnosis lacks a gold standard, relying on clinical evaluation.
- Current imaging techniques like PET and MRI are not widely accessible or cost-effective for HE detection.
- Existing diagnostic methods for HE are often nonspecific.
Purpose of the Study:
- To review the current diagnostic landscape for hepatic encephalopathy.
- To explore the potential utility of electroencephalography (EEG) in diagnosing minimal HE.
- To identify gaps in current diagnostic capabilities for HE.
Main Methods:
- Literature review of diagnostic modalities for hepatic encephalopathy.
- Evaluation of the role of imaging techniques (PET, MRI) in HE detection.
- Assessment of electroencephalography (EEG) in conjunction with the Portal Systemic Hepatic Encephalopathy Score (PSHES).
Main Results:
- No definitive serologic or imaging biomarker currently exists for HE.
- PET and MRI show limited utility due to availability and cost.
- EEG, combined with PSHES, demonstrates potential for diagnosing minimal HE.
Conclusions:
- Hepatic encephalopathy diagnosis remains primarily clinical.
- Further research is needed to establish criteria, cutoffs, sensitivities, and specificities for EEG in HE diagnosis.
- Developing reliable diagnostic tools for HE is crucial for patient management.
